Mykola Petrovych Budnyk Ukrainian: ????´?? ?????´??? ?????? was a luthier and traditional performer in the Kobzar tradition.
He was active in authentic construction and recreation of historic folk instruments, and involved in the movement for authentic perform?nce practice on Ukrainian folk instruments.
Budnyk was also known as a painter and poet.
He was born in 1954 in Skolobiv, near Khoroshiv, Zhytomyr region, and died January 16, 2001, in Irpin', Kyiv region.
He was chairman of the Kiev Kobzar Guild (Kobzarskyi Tsekh), bandura, known as a master player of folk musical instruments, and as an artist and poet.
